Mission The Export‑Import Compliance Officer (EX/IM CO) will support reputed company USA, Inc. and its affiliates with strategic and daily export and import compliance, anti‑corruption programs, and reputed company issues. These activities include reputed company relating to U.S. Trade Regulations, such as, but not limited to, the Export Administration Regulations (EAR), the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R), the Foreign Trade Regulations (FTR), the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C), the Foreign Corrupt Practices reputed company (FCPA), and the reputed company (CBP) Regulations (reputed company reputed company as U.S. Trade Regulations). The EX/IM CO will establish and implement procedures to ensure compliance with the above listed Regulations along with assisting with the development and dissemination of reputed company USA's export, import, and anti‑corruption compliance tools and training materials to reputed company's internal US business entities (Business Entities). This is a remote position and reports to the Sr. Counsel, Global Trade & Compliance. Job Responsibilities
- Interpret U.S. trade regulations (ITAR, EAR, FTR, FCPA, OFAC and Customs) and reputed company guidance to internal Business Entities.
- Assist with research and fact‑finding work as needed.
- reputed company with Compliance Teams and other internal functions (Program Management, reputed company, Procurement, Supply Chain, Engineering) and Senior Leadership to ensure reputed company work processes are in compliance with U.S. Trade Regulations.
- Draft and update import/export/anti‑corruption procedures, instructions, forms, and templates.
- Assist in establishing and maintaining a comprehensive export/import compliance program consistent with corporate guidance.
- Assist internal Business Entities with classification requests (USML, ECCN, Schedule B, HTS).
- Review screening alerts and address potential reputed company hits.
- Conduct export/import and anti‑corruption trainings to internal Business Entities.
- Support user accounts for reputed company's secure file transfer tool.
- Investigate and resolve compliance issues.
- Conduct export and import audits for internal Business Entities.
- Support internal Business Entities with self‑assessment programs and investigations.
- Collaborate with compliance teams on reputed company, conferences, audits, assessments, reports, etc.
- Help reputed company understanding and compliance with ethics laws and conflicts of interest.
- Support the deployment of the reputed company anti‑corruption program.
- Draft compliance‑reputed company communications.
- Support the regular U.S. Customs Coordination Committee meetings and reputed company the Tariff Working Group.
- Support the reputed company USA, Inc.'s DDTC Registration filings as needed.
- Conduct risk assessments for SUSA and possibly other Business Entities in the U.S.
- reputed company guidance on a broad reputed company of import and export reputed company, including CF28/29, tariff applicability determinations, documentation, recordkeeping, license determination, classification, reputed company determination, valuation, screening/KYC, and incoterms.
